Wind Turbine proposed for Queensway

Wind turbine
Artist impression of the wind turbine

A planning application has been submitted for a 2 mega watt wind turbine at Marline Fields, Queensway, and we are interested to hear your views.  The application has been submitted by Seaspace who are developing the adjacent business park.

You can view the application details and comment online or view the application at Century House or Hastings Information Centre.

Volume 2 of the Environmental Statement includes computer-generated images of the turbine proposed turbine.

A display with information about the application is also being arranged within the Tesco store, on Churchwood Drive, from 23 January 2009 for a minimum period of 3 weeks.

Any comments should be submitted by 13 February 2008
